Where Are The Migrant Restaurants on the Gastronomic Field? A Theoretical Introduction to Immigrant Neighborhood, Refugee Cuisine and Spatial Segregation

Abstract

Since 2011, immigrants from Syria, Pakistan, and Iraq move their cultural assets, specifically their culinary culture, to herein Turkey through opening ethnic food markets, kiosks, and restaurants. Immigrant neighborhoods which generally discussed regarding consumption and leisure industry in London or Berlin case, follow another sort of pattern in Istanbul, the one, in some respect unique. In this study, immigrant restaurants located in Istanbul’s different three subprovince, Bagcilar, Esenler, and Sultangazi, is discussed regarding their spatial process and their position in Istanbul’s food-scape will be discussed. In this discussion, Istanbul’s long-term relationship with immigrant and migration, in-group and out-group perception of immigrant restaurants neighborhoods and consumption of ethnic cuisines to gentrification literature to gentrification and the function of these immigrant restaurants is considered.
